Volleyball is a popular team sport in which two teams of six players are separated by a net. Each team tries to score points by grounding a ball on the other team's court under organized rules. The complete set of rules are extensive, [2] but play essentially proceeds as follows: a player on one of the teams begins a 'rally' by serving the ball tossing or releasing it and then hitting it with a hand or arm , from behind the back boundary line of the court, over the net, and into the receiving team's court. The team may touch the ball up to 3 times, but individual players may not touch the ball twice consecutively. The rally continues, with each team allowed as many as three consecutive touches, until either 1 : a team makes a kill , grounding the ball on the opponent's court and winning the rally; or 2 : a team commits a fault and loses the rally. The team that wins the rally is awarded a point and serves the ball to start the next rally.
If you have ever seen indoor or beach volleyball being played, you are probably aware of the major differences between the sports. For example, one is played on the beach, while the other takes place in a gymnasium. In addition, indoor volleyball has a larger court with six players per side, while beach volleyball at least the organized professional version is played with only two players on each team. Less experienced players might not know, however, that the scoring is different in each sport, as indoor volleyball consists of five sets, while outdoor volleyball is only played to three sets.
